Understanding Ecological Marble


Ecological marble, often referred to as sustainable or green marble, is a refined natural stone that emphasizes environmental responsibility. Unlike traditional marble, which is often quarried in a manner that contributes to habitat destruction and significant ecological footprints, ecological marble is sourced and processed using methods that minimize environmental impact.
This material is typically created using recycled marble dust or waste from quarrying processes, which is then combined with resins and other natural materials. This innovative approach not only conserves resources but also transforms by-products into valuable materials for home renovation. Understanding the fundamentals of ecological marble is crucial for homeowners looking to integrate it seamlessly into their renovation projects.

Maintenance Tips for Ecological Marble


To preserve the beauty and longevity of ecological marble, follow these maintenance tips:

1. Regular Cleaning


Use a soft cloth and gentle, pH-neutral cleaner to wipe down surfaces regularly. Avoid harsh chemicals that can damage the stone.

2. Promptly Address Spills


Immediately clean up spills, particularly acidic substances like lemon juice or vinegar, which can etch the surface.

3. Use Coasters and Trivets


To prevent scratches and heat damage, always use coasters under drinks and trivets under hot pots.

4. Periodic Sealing


Re-seal the marble surface every 6 to 12 months, depending on usage, to maintain its protective barrier against stains and moisture.

5. Professional Care


Consider hiring professionals for deep cleaning and restoration every few years to keep the marble looking its best.

Cost Considerations


When planning to incorporate ecological marble into your home renovations, it's essential to consider the costs involved:

1. Material Costs


Ecological marble typically ranges from $50 to $150 per square foot, depending on the quality, thickness, and design. This can vary significantly based on your choice of supplier and specific product features.

2. Installation Costs


Professional installation costs can range from $30 to $100 per hour, depending on the complexity of the job and local labor rates. Factor in additional costs for customization and any necessary prep work.

3. Maintenance Costs


Consider the long-term costs associated with maintenance, such as sealing and cleaning products, when budgeting for your renovation.

4. Return on Investment


While the initial costs may be higher than traditional materials, ecological marble can increase your home's value and appeal to environmentally-conscious buyers, making it a worthwhile investment.
